Teak Floor Refinishing Questions
What is involved in teak floor refinishing? The process typically includes sanding the surface to remove old finish and imperfections, followed by applying a new protective coating for a smooth, durable finish.
Can teak floors be refinished multiple times? Yes, teak floors can often be refinished several times, depending on the thickness of the wood and the extent of wear.
What types of projects benefit from teak floor refinishing? Refinishing is ideal for restoring the appearance of worn or damaged teak floors in residential or commercial spaces.
Is teak floor refinishing suitable for all types of damage? It is effective for surface scratches, dullness, and minor dents, but deeper structural damage may require additional repairs.
